The Ella Rock Hike: A Highlight for Active Travelers

The hike to Ella Rock is the star of the show for many visitors. It takes about 3 to 3.5 hours round trip and involves walking along the railway track, crossing tea plantations, and hiking through forested areas. The guide ensures safety and points out native flora and interesting landmarks along the way, making it a rich educational experience as well.

From the summit, you are rewarded with breathtaking views of the Ella Gap and surrounding valleys. The scenery is nothing short of spectacular, especially if you’re lucky enough to catch a clear day. Visiting the Nine Arches Bridge: An Architectural Wonder

After descending from Ella Rock, you’ll visit the Nine Arches Bridge, often called the “Bridge in the Sky.” Built entirely of bricks and stone—without steel—this colonial relic is a marvel of engineering. Surrounded by tea plantations and jungle, it’s an ideal spot for photographs. If you’re fortunate, you’ll see a train crossing slowly across the arches, adding an authentic and picturesque touch to your visit.

The Demodara Railway Loop: A Mechanical Marvel

Next, you’ll explore the Demodara Loop, where the railway track loops around itself beneath a tunnel—a clever solution to climbing the steep terrain. Watching a train navigate this loop provides insight into Sri Lanka’s colonial-era ingenuity. Your guide will explain the engineering behind it, turning a simple train ride into an educational moment.

If train schedules align, you might see a train pass through the loop, which is quite the sight. It’s an excellent example of how transportation infrastructure in Sri Lanka combines functionality with picturesque scenery.

Ravana Falls: Nature’s Refreshing Stop

After lunch, you’ll visit Ravana Falls, a 25-meter cascade dropped into a rocky pool. Its mythical connection to the Ramayana saga adds a layer of mystique. The cool mist from the falls is refreshing, and you can dip your feet in the shallow stream or snap photos of this stunning natural feature.

Little Adams Peak: Easy Hiking and Sunset Magic

To cap off the day, a shorter and gentler walk takes you up to Little Adams Peak. It takes around 20 to 30 minutes to reach the top, and the gentle trail makes it accessible for most fitness levels. From the summit, you’ll see panoramic views of tea plantations, distant waterfalls, and Ella Rock itself.

If timing works out, you might catch the sunset, adding a magical glow to the scenery. This last stop is a favorite among travelers for its peaceful atmosphere and stunning vistas.
